  • Does the NavigationController work only when placed in appDelegate?

    I am trying to build application that has a tab bar controller with two view and the first view contains a segmented control.
    Based on the decision of the segmented control, I load the tableview. The table view has an instance of navigation Controller in which I have assigned the tableview controller as a rootview controller. When I click on any row of the table view, a new controller gets pushed on the table view. In my case, the new view does not show up on the screen, once the row is clicked. I used NSlog and checked that the views pushed on the stack are correct.
    I read many threads here and saw that all of them use tabBarController and then it directly uses the navigationController and viewcontroller. Is this the only config that works ?
    What if I want to have a tabBarController->tableViewController->NavigationController, isn't it possible? Can anyone please help?

    WitchKing wrote:
    So, if I understand this fully, I can initialize the navigation controller as soon as the any row is clicked and put the tableView I am on as my rootView for the navController. and also push the next view controller I want to see, on its stack. and present the navigation controller's view.
    The usual way to implement a table view drill-down would be to make the first table view (or the content view which includes it) the root view of the nav controller. I.e. the table view's controller would be the root controller. When you do it that way all the objects will do what they were designed to do, and the code to push and pop subsequent views will almost write itself.
    However there's no reason you can't do what you described, which (if I understood) would be to attach the nav controller's view to the hierarchy only after a row in the table is selected. Note however, that you couldn't then expect the nav controller to make that first transition from the parent table view. You would have to provide your own transition to the nav controller's view.
    You bring up a good point in any case. I never explicitly answered the question in the Subject line of this thread.
    does the NavigationController work only when placed in appDelegate?
    No, there is no requirement to create a nav controller in any particular position of the view hierarchy. Unlike a tab controller, a nav controller need not be the root of the hierarchy (i.e. added directly to the key window). In fact you'll find several examples in the docs which show one or more nav controllers under some other controller.
    there might be some problem with adjusting bar heights and etc though.
    I'm not sure you proposed anything that would make it difficult to configure a table view. One nav controller issue that will impact table view position and size is the attempt to hide the nav bar which would otherwise appear above the table.   • Manually adding music to ipod using itunes ver 7.0.2

    i downloaded the latest itunes (7.0.2 i think) and wish too add music to my ipod manually rather than have it sync automatically upon connection.
    i unchecked the sync automatically box in ipod options which wiped my ipod clean (for some reason??) however, i can't figure out how to add the music manually. i have it all ready in the library but can't get it on my ipod.
    any help?

    Connect your iPod and click on it's icon when it appears in the iTunes Source list. This will bring up the Summary tab in the main pane. Check the "manually manage songs and videos" box and click Apply. Once it's in manual mode click on the Music icon in the source list to display your library and drag whetever content you want to the iPod icon: Managing content manually on iPod

  • Does Bridge Mode Work only with Apple Router?

    Can I use an Airport Extreme Router, in Bridge Mode, as a wireless bridge in a network that does not use an Apple Router?
    Situation:  Wifi Hotspot from Smartphone connects to Dlink Wireless Bridge in other room allowing Wifi access to printers having only Hard-Wired Ethernet connections.  Trying to do the same with an Airport Extreme, with same network name and password, in bridge mode, to provide a PC internet access through the Ethernet connection to Airport Extreme.  Cannot seem to get the Airport Extreme in Bridge Mode to function as a wireless bridge on this network.

    Are both of your AirPort Extreme models the "ac" version?
    So Base Station (2) would be set to bridge mode, hard wired to Station (1).  Base Station (2) - I believe in this configuration will broadcast the wireless signal from Station (1), the router, with all DHCP addressing handled by Station (1).
    No, Base Station 2 would not broadcast the wireless signal from Base Station 1. Base Station 2 would broadcast its own wireless signal, which it derives from the Ethernet connection coming from Base Station 1.
    You don't have to worry about "bridge mode" if you use Apple's "wizard" to set things up in AirPort Utility.
    If the wireless on Base 2 is configured to use the same wireless network name and password as Base 1, then Base 2 will act like an "extender", and it will seem as if you have one "big" network. This type of setup is called a Roaming Network.
    Base Station 2 would only broadcast the wireless signal from Base 1....IF....Base 2 was connecting using wireless. But, you changed the question to ask about Base 1 and Base 2 connecting using Ethernet.
